Herausforderung
Mark ist ein Student, der seine N
Noten verkettet in einer einzigen Zeile erhält .
Die Herausforderung besteht darin, seine Marken zu trennen, in dem Wissen, dass jede Marke nur 0
oder 1
oder 2
oder 3
oder 4
oder 5
oder 6
oder 7
oder 8
oder 9
oder sein kann 10
.
Eingang
N
natürliche Zahl und eine Zeile.
Ausgabe
Eine Reihe von natürlichen Zahlen.
Beispiel
N, One line------------------> Set of marks
3, '843'---------------------> [8, 4, 3]
1, '0'-----------------------> [0]
2, '1010'--------------------> [10,10]
3, '1010'--------------------> [1,0,10] or [10,1,0]
4, '1010'--------------------> [1,0,1,0]
9, '23104441070'-------------> [2, 3, 10, 4, 4, 4, 10, 7, 0]
12,'499102102121103'---------> [4, 9, 9, 10, 2, 10, 2, 1, 2, 1, 10, 3]
5, '71061'-------------------> [7, 1, 0, 6, 1]
11,'476565010684'------------> [4, 7, 6, 5, 6, 5, 0, 10, 6, 8, 4]
4, '1306'--------------------> [1, 3, 0, 6]
9, '51026221084'-------------> [5, 10, 2, 6, 2, 2, 10, 8, 4]
14,'851089085685524'---------> [8, 5, 10, 8, 9, 0, 8, 5, 6, 8, 5, 5, 2, 4]
11,'110840867780'------------> [1, 10, 8, 4, 0, 8, 6, 7, 7, 8, 0]
9, '4359893510'--------------> [4, 3, 5, 9, 8, 9, 3, 5, 10]
7, '99153710'----------------> [9, 9, 1, 5, 3, 7, 10]
14,'886171092313495'---------> [8, 8, 6, 1, 7, 10, 9, 2, 3, 1, 3, 4, 9, 5]
2, '44'----------------------> [4, 4]
4, '9386'--------------------> [9, 3, 8, 6]
Regeln
- Wenn mehrere Ausgänge möglich sind, geben Sie nur einen Ausgang an.
- Nur die Wertmarke
10
steht auf zwei Dezimalstellen, andere auf einer Dezimalstelle. - Die Ein- und Ausgabe kann in jedem beliebigen Format erfolgen
- Keine Notwendigkeit, ungültige Eingaben zu verarbeiten
- Es ist entweder ein vollständiges Programm oder eine Funktion zulässig. Bei einer Funktion können Sie die Ausgabe zurückgeben, anstatt sie zu drucken.
- Fügen Sie nach Möglichkeit einen Link zu einer Online-Testumgebung hinzu, damit andere Benutzer Ihren Code ausprobieren können!
- Standardlücken sind verboten.
- Dies ist Codegolf, daher gelten alle üblichen Golfregeln, und der kürzeste Code (in Byte) gewinnt.
n, 'string'
Paare aus dem kopierten Beispieltextblock abgerufen habe:spl = [item.split('-')[0] for item in text.split('\n')]